The Different Types of Online Baccarat

Baccarat’s been around a good while – quite possibly since the Middle Ages. So it’s no surprise that the generations have handed down a few twists on this classic casino game. Without going into too much detail, let’s run through those you’re most likely to encounter at UK casinos.

Classic Baccarat

Classic version is very much the game we’ve outlined above, and it's available at all online baccarat sites by default. The player has the choice to either wager on their own hand, the banker’s hand, or the tie. 

There might also be the opportunity to place side bets such as player pair, perfect pair, or either pair. There will be a minimum and maximum stake for each of the classic baccarat tables.

Speed Baccarat

The clue’s in the name. This variant is a classic played in turbo mode. Whereas a round usually takes anywhere up to 60 seconds, speed baccarat sees rounds wrapped up in less than 30.  

Since the cards are dealt so much quicker, there’s often the option to automatically start the next hand for the same stake or bet. It doesn’t leave you with much thinking time, so it’s best for experienced players who have a good handle on what’s happening and know their strategies.

Punto Banco

Punto banco isn’t a huge departure from classic baccarat, all things considered. The player (punto) goes up against the banker (banco) one on one, just the same. 

The difference here is the house edge – 1.17% for the banker, 1.36% for the player and 14% for a tie. See our table above for how that compares with the classic version. 

Mini Baccarat

Mini baccarat is the same game as its classic version, with the main difference being that you play on a smaller table and for lower stakes. It’s a good starting point for newcomers – you can get a feel for the game without any risk of burning through your bankroll. 

Though you may want to graduate on after a while, as just like everything else here, the payouts are smaller.

A Simple Introduction to Baccarat

Baccarat is a total classic in the casino world. Many players online and in person play it every single day. But hey, we've all got to start somewhere, and it's okay to admit you're new to this legendary table game.

Even if you know the game, it's a good idea to brush up on your knowledge before you start. You don't want to burn through your money too fast, especially if you're using a welcome bonus. Let's go over the basics together.

The aim of the game: get a hand as close to nine as possible, and end up closer than the dealer’s hand in doing so. 

Key points:

  • Before a game starts, you’ll bet a stake of your choosing on a hand. You can bet on yourself as the player, back the banker’s hand, or call a tie. 
  • To play the game, you'll use six or eight full decks or cards.
  • The cards numbered from two to nine carry their face value.
  • Any ace card represents a value of one.
  • 10s, jacks, queens and kings have a value of zero.
  • Suits have no relevancy here, it’s all about the numbers.
  • If you end up running past nine – and you will – you drop the first digit from your total. So a hand with a value of 13 drops the one and leaves you with a value of three.
  • You and the banker will get two cards each. If either has a sum of eight or nine in your hand, the game ends. It’s called a ‘natural’ win.
  • If either hand adds up to between zero and five, you get dealt another card. The one closest to nine wins, unless it's a tie.

If you bet on the right outcome, you win cash. Put your money on the player or the banker, and you'll double your bet. Ties don't happen often, and if you predict one, you could get a payout eight or nine times your stake. 

Check out the table below for all the details. Also, notice a slight advantage for the house on player or banker bets.

Bet TypeOddsPayoutHouse Edge
Player’s hand45.86%1:11.36%
Banker’s hand44.62%1:11.06%
Tie9.52%8:1 or 9:114.4%

 

But – and it’s a big but – these are classic playing rules. Remember that many different baccarat games are out there with their own rules. Although they're similar, it's important to know the differences and adjust your strategies.

Tips and Tricks to Play Online Baccarat the Smart Way

On the face of it, baccarat is a luck-based game. And that’s a pretty fair assessment. But, you can still be smart about how you play it, whether that means using in-game strategies, knowing when to stop, or managing your bankroll.

We can't promise these tips will make you a pro. But from our experience, they'll definitely help.

1. Look for the Smallest House Edge

The most obvious tip is to reduce the house margin as much as possible at online baccarat sites. Choosing a table with a high RTP means a better chance of winning, regardless of whether you’re betting on the player or banker.

2. Don’t Bet on the Tie and Avoid Side Bets

Sure, the tie comes with the tempting prospect of a massive payout. But it’s something of a false economy, due to a significantly bigger house margin that’s built in. The same applies to the various forms of side bets that are sometimes included. Stick to your guns and play straight bets on the banker or player.

3. Choose a Sensible Staking Plan

Baccarat is a luck-based game and you should think about how much you are prepared to gamble. Think both about the amount you will stake in each round and what your limit for the session will be. 

4. Know When to Take a Profit

If you manage to land a few successful hands at baccarat and everything seems to be going your way, ask if it’s time to take the money and dash. It can be tempting to continue when it feels like you’re onto something – but luck eventually runs out. 

5. And When to Cut Your Losses

With baccarat being so very luck-based and with a house edge built in, you shouldn’t always expect to come off well. And there may not be some big turnaround on the horizon. Sometimes you just need to walk away and try again another day. 

6. Stick to the Same Bet

It can be tempting to jump off the horse if you’ve had a succession of losing bets on the banker or player. But it’s even more frustrating if you switch sides and then lose with that selection. 

7. Keep a Record of Your Baccarat Play

Make a note of your profits and losses from each online baccarat session. It’ll give you a clearer idea of how things are going and whether playing this game is worthwhile for you.
